Job Responsibilities:
Maintain constant surveillance of patrons in the facility; act immediately and appropriately to secure safety of patrons in the event of emergency.
Organize and lead various water activities, including swimming lessons.
Guide individuals and/or groups in proper swimming techniques and water safety.
Provide reliable customer service by maintaining the overall commitment to facility programs.
Maintain and submit reports and records as required.
Attend staff meetings and training sessions as required.
Maintain cleanliness and safety for the pool and the area inside the pool enclosure, including the men’s and women’s restrooms.
Operate and perform basic maintenance to pool filtering system.
Build and maintain positive working relationships with co-workers, other City employees, and the public using principles of good customer service.
Observe and maintain a safe working environment in compliance with established safety programs and procedures.
